Chapter 13-
Moment of Preparation

Caleb and Sarah's training being complete, they both would be ready for war. Ready to stop the foxes and overthrow Cuttler. But most importantly, to save Tyler. After three weeks, Caleb and Sarah were prepared for anything. They wanted to go out in the field and fight. They wanted to prove just how capable they are. Colonel Grand gathered all of the soldiers for forming a battle plan. They all were forming in the commanding wing. Everyone was dressed and in uniform, gun at the ready in case of a sudden attack on the bunker. Caleb and Sarah did the same, fully armed; Caleb with his rifle, and Sarah with her sword. As Colonel Grand entered the room, everyone stood at attention.
"Now listen, people, this is the one point where we have to put all of out heads together to form a battle plan." Grand announced with a stern and loud voice, "The first thing we need to do is figure out the landscape we have available to our advantage." A huge projection came onto the huge screen at the front of the room, Breaker at the keyboard, "We are going to manipulate every square inch of this area. There will be no place that we aren't there. Now, there are the buildings, which will serve as a crow's nest for our sniping team. Since we are setting for an ambush at the old town just six miles from our current location, we must use as many roofs and balconies as we can cover. Now for the ground infantry, you will be hiding inside the buildings. The small town is right in between the Fox Military base and ours, so they should make a straight pass through it, giving us the advantage. Helicopters will be dropping all of the infantry off exactly at twenty-four hundred the next day, giving us plenty of time to get some rest, load our bullets, and knock some fox heads." Colonel Grand finished, giving a devious smile, confident in his thought out plan, "You are all dismissed. Get ready, gather food and weapons, and go to sleep early tonight. Tomorrow, the war begins." Everyone left the room to prepare for their soon to come fight. Colonel Grand stopped Caleb and Sarah, "You two, come here." He ordered, gesturing towards the computer. The two of them followed.
"What is it, Colonel?" Caleb asked him.
"Now listen, you two, because this is very important." He whispered, making sure no one was around or listening, "I need you two to accompany me on a special mission. This concerns both of you and you especially, Caleb. We're going to save your brother." Grand said. Caleb was surprised. He had forgot all about saving Tyler until now, and was ready to face Cuttler and save his ransomed brother, "So, you two are going to come with me to infiltrate Cuttler's base, and you are to follow my orders the entire way, understand?"
"Yes, sir." They both said. They were free to go, and they left to prepare for battle. They got their uniforms on, along with their dog tags, and readied their weapons. Caleb was loading his rifle and pistol, while Sarah was sharpening her sword. They both put on lightweight, sturdy armor and bulletproof vests.
"Caleb?" Sarah spoke up. They were both in their quarters, alone.
"Yeah?"
"What if..." Sarah stopped herself.
"What if what?" Caleb asked.
"What if we don't make it? I mean, I know that we can do it, but… what if we don't make it back, and we can't stop Cuttler and save your brother?" Sarah was concerned. She didn't know how this was going to turn out. If anything, she was terrified. Caleb turned to her. He walked over and put his paw on her shoulder.
"It's going to be fine. We're going to be fine." He said, smiling. Sarah rushed him and hugged him, almost crying. Without a word, they went back to their preparation work. After they were finished, they put them next to their beds. They even slept in their uniforms that night, ready to get up at any time, even at midnight.

= = =

"Caleb, Caleb, wake up." Caleb was aroused by Sarah's voice again. He knew it was time. He leaped out of bed and grabbed his weapons and ammunition. Both of them then ran to the choppers. They all knew it was time to face the Fox Military, and defeat them. They knew what was at stake in this war, and they took the chances to save their country, maybe even the world, from Cuttler and his illegal army. They all knew that if this mission wasn't completed, that they would either die, or be captured and tormented, but they had to take those chances. They had to face those odds in hope of success. Those with families were grieving in their hearts, unsure whether they would make it back, almost crying. Caleb and Sarah looked at each other as the helicopter took flight. They too, were worried.
"You ready, Sarah?" Caleb asked.
"Ready as I'll ever be." She answered. By this time, they were in the air, soaring over the sandy area, and they reached the small town within thirty minutes. Once Caleb got off the helicopter, he was amazed at the sight. The town seemed abandoned. There was no sign of movement, no sign of life. The town was in ruins, the only thing moving were the awnings on the small buildings. All of the houses were either broken or caved in. They knew that the Fox Military was here. There was no denying it.
"Looks like they bombed the place." Caleb said.
"They bomb any city they come across to gain territory. Damn beasts. They make me sick. Cuttler's worked them all like animals, no mercy, no restraint." Hunter replied, walking right beside Caleb, guns ready for anything that may come out.
"It looks to me as if there's nobody here, I think we're safe." Shade sounded, just getting off the helicopter, Sarah following close behind.
"My sonar indicates that there's no life form here besides us." Breaker responded.
"Well then, we need to find our places in this God-forbidden town. Everyone, ready your communication systems and find a spot to hide until the Fox Military arrives." Colonel Grand ordered, "No one moves without my command." With that said, everyone found a place to stay. They figured they would only be there for a few hours, just waiting.

= = =

"Well, looks like you're finally coming out of that little cage." The evil colonel said to Tyler, "You may be of some use in this war after all." He grabbed the little wolf by the scruff of the neck, pulling him out and dragging his body along. He gathered his troops, gave them all orders, and they all marched out. Colonel Cuttler took his knife, along with a sword, and took Tyler along with him, getting into his dune rider and driving out. All of his troops and fleets followed in their own vehicles. There were maybe a hundred vehicles running along the ground, each one holding about seven foxes in them, all ready to fight and crush the Wolf Military, and to show that they are the superior race, just as any powerful, mad-hungry leader thought they were the dominant race, such has Cuttler thought in this manner, inheriting the madness, the power, and the ferocity. He was a dictator in his own world, being self-proclaimed as a deity, a god. He was intelligent, powerful, and seen in the eyes of the public as a natural-born leader, though he was foolish in many ways. He only thought of acquiring ultimate authority over the world, to be sitting on the throne of kings, and to control all that there is to control. This was his goal. This was his folly.
